Investor sentiment experienced a decline due to recent developments in China, notably the significant public offering of ChangXin Memory Technologies (CXMT). The listing has been closely watched by market participants, particularly given the growing importance of semiconductor manufacturing in global supply chains.
Additionally, reports have surfaced indicating that a state-backed Chinese company has commenced production of immersion deep ultraviolet (DUV) lithography equipment, a critical technology used in the fabrication of advanced semiconductor chips. This move is seen as part of China’s broader strategy to enhance its domestic semiconductor capabilities and reduce reliance on foreign technology.
These developments could have far-reaching implications for the semiconductor industry, affecting not only market dynamics but also geopolitical relationships, as countries navigate the complexities of technology transfer and trade in this critical sector.
